Understanding the cost of production is pivotal for any manufacturing business aiming to optimize its operations and maximize profitability. A Cost of Production Report (CPR) serves as a comprehensive document that outlines the total cost incurred during the production process. By dissecting the nuances of these costs, manufacturers can identify inefficiencies, adjust pricing strategies, and enhance their decision-making process. The cost of production report (CPR) is a document used in process costing system that summarizes information about the flow of units and costs through the work in process account of a processing department.

The Google Pixel 9 Pro costs around Rs $406 or Rs 34,000 approximately, to manufacture, according to a recent report. That’s not only less than half of its retail price in India, it is also 11 per cent lower manufacturing costs as compared to that of the Pixel 8 Pro. It claims that the Pixel 9 Pro’s material costs for Google come to about $406. This cost has been further broken down by analyst @Jukanlosreve in a post on X.
